3. Watch a movie at Enzian Theater

Editor's Note: Photo taken from the establishment's official social account

One of the best date nights that you can experience in Orlando is by spending it at the cozy Enzian Theater, one of the first dine-in theaters in the city. The theater is home to the prestigious Florida Film Festival every April. It also regularly shows amazing and award-winning indie films, classic movies, and great selections on its outdoor screen every other Wednesday night. Make sure to buy your tickets online in advance for a hassle-free movie night experience with your loved one.

4. Stroll around and take a swan boat ride at Lake Eola

The Paramount on Lake Eola
Source: Photo by Wikimedia Commons user Peter Dutton used under CC BY 2.0

Walking and strolling through a park while holding each other’s hands at night is a staple when it comes to date nights. The best place to do this in Orlando is at Lake Eola. Spend the night just talking and appreciating the environment at the Pagoda Gazebo, where you can have the best views of the lake, especially when the fountain and the gazebo itself get lit up at night. You can also paddle and get cozy across the lake with your special someone by renting one of their swan paddle boats.

5. Have a movie night at Leu Garden

Leu Gardens
Source: Photo by Flickr user R9 Studios FL (Th... used under CC BY 2.0

When the skies are clear and the stars are lit at night, you and your special someone can spread a blanket, snuggle up, and watch a movie at the gorgeous Harry P. Leu Gardens. This beautiful 50-acre (20.23-hectare) park in Florida is known for its movie nights every first Friday of the month where hundreds of couples spend their night watching romantic and blockbuster movies. The garden also has beautiful green leaves, sweet-smelling flowers, chirping birds, fluttering butterflies, and buzzing bees, making it as beautiful as it is tranquil. It’s the perfect place to take a long romantic walk and simply enjoy each other’s company after the movie.

7. Gaze at the stars at Crosby Observatory

Observatory
Source: Photo by Wikimedia Commons user Astroval1 used under CC BY-SA 4.0

Who said science and astronomy can’t be romantic? At the top of Orlando Science Center is Crosby Observatory, a domed observatory where you and your special someone can see the planets, stars, and other celestial objects if your timing is right. Both of you will surely find seeing Jupiter’s moons, Saturn’s rings, galaxies, and nebulas romantic as you spend the evening at the observatory.

9. Spend the night at Disney Springs

Top Date Night Ideas In Orlando, Florida
Source: Photo by Wikimedia Commons user elisfkc used under CC BY-SA 2.0

Known to be Walt Disney World’s entertainment district, there’s surely a lot of fun and romantic things that you and your partner can do for a date night in Disney Springs. This amazing amusement park has a total of 120 acres (49 hectares) and is divided into four neighborhoods, namely The Landing, Marketplace, West Side, and Town Center. Each of these neighborhoods boasts of its great boutiques, world-renowned restaurants, and world-class entertainment. The best way to spend your date night in Disney Springs is by having a great dinner at one of the restaurants and watching a movie at the 24-screen AMC cinema complex.

10. See the entirety of Orlando from The Wheel at ICON Park

date night ideas in orlando | see the entirety of orlando from the wheel at icon park

Known to be one of the most glimmering entertainment districts in Orlando, ICON 360 has a lot to offer for an unforgettable date night. The star of the entertainment district is ICON Orlando, the tallest observation wheel on the United States’ east coast. Get to see the whole city of Orlando from a bird’s-eye view as the wheel takes you 400 feet (122 meters) up in the sky.

14. Park Avenue

Park Ave Shoppes 21
Source: Photo by Wikimedia Commons user Miosotis jade used under CC BY-SA 4.0

Park Avenue is a street in downtown Winter Park. It is the go-to place for anything trendy. It has a collection of boutiques, restaurants, café, hotels, and artwork. It is also close to Florida’s Central Park. Central Park is the perfect place for a long romantic walk under the shade of the many oak trees. In fact, it has the same vibe as a classic European village! Park Avenue also has a number of stylish lounges where you can spend the evening together over a cocktail and good music. The whole street has a lot to offer to couples looking for a fun time together.
